SUMMARY:Intellectual Property Roadshow
DESCRIPTION:The U.S. Commercial Service Long Island in conjunction with Carter\, DeLuca & Farrell LLP will host a STOPfakes.gov Roadshow seminar on Wednesday\, November 6\, 2019.  The STOPfakes program will deliver critically important information about intellectual property to the audience that needs it most – start-ups\, entrepreneurs\, small and medium-sized businesses\, independent creators\, and inventors. The information will be presented by experts from multiple government agencies that deal with intellectual property issues. \nParticipants will learn: \n\nHow to identify and protect the various intellectual property assets they have\nThe mechanisms for obtaining IP protection in overseas markets and strategies for determining where they should seek protection\nHow to record their mark with Customs\, in order to exclude counterfeit goods from entering the United States\nHow to combat counterfeits on international e-commerce sites\nGovernment resources available to help U.S. businesses with intellectual property issues.\n\nWHAT YOU NEED TO KNOW ABOUT THIS EVENT: \n  \nWHAT: STOPfakes.gov Roadshow (Intellectual Property Rights Seminar) \nWHEN: 8:30AM-2:00PM\,  (Registration & Breakfast begins at 8:30 AM)\nWHERE: Carter\, DeLuca & Farrell LLP\, 576 Broad Hollow Road\nMelville\, NY 11747\nCOST: $35 per person (includes light breakfast and lunch) \nREGISTRATION REQUIRED \nProgram Benefits: \n\nOne-on-One Participants can meet with the speakers for 10-minute sessions to discuss an IP issue they have.\nApply for Copyright and Trademark Recordation On-Site On-site assistance is made available by CBP staff to navigate the recordation application portal and process.\nApply for Copyright Registration On-site Copyright Office staff will be on-site to help you with the application required to register your work online.\n\nU.S. Government Participation\nU.S. Customs and Border Protection \nInternational Trade Administration \nNational IPR Center \nU.S. Patent and Trademark Office \nU.S. Copyright Office \nFederal Bureau of Investigation\nand more!\nREGISTER HERE \nFor questions about the program contact: \nSusan.Sadocha@trade.gov
